Hunte's Gardens and Bajan Art

Today was a day for a little culture - so I headed off to a place I've never been - Hunte's Gardens. It is truly beautiful there, beautifully maintained and a tiny piece of paradise. I took so many photos that it was hard to choose one  to show here -I just picked this view of the trees to show the backdrop to the gardens. They are well planted with bright coloured flowers and little statues hidden amongst the plants. With every step there was something new to see.
I forgot how much the rain came down last night and stepped off the path - big mistake - squelchy mud. I had to get someone to hose my feet down - including between my toes!
